line-height
时间: 2023-08-04 07:07:26 浏览: 18
line-height是CSS中的一个属性,用于设置行高。它定义了行框盒子的最小高度,包括行框内的所有内容、内边距和边框。行高可以是一个数值、一个百分比值或一个无单位的数值。它可以影响文本在行框盒子中的垂直对齐方式、行之间的间距以及行框盒子的高度。通过调整line-height属性值,可以使文本在页面上的排版更加美观、清晰、易读。
相关问题
line-height自适应
line-height属性用于设置文本行之间的间距。如果要实现line-height的自适应效果,可以使用相对单位或百分比来设置line-height的值,以根据文本内容的大小自动调整行间距。
例如,可以使用相对单位em来设置line-height的值,如下所示:
```css
p {
line-height: 1.5em;
}
```
这将使每一行的高度是文本字号(font-size)的1.5倍,从而实现了自适应的行高。如果字号变大或变小,行高也会相应调整。
另外,还可以使用百分比来设置line-height的值。例如,设置为150%将使每一行的高度为默认字号的1.5倍:
```css
p {
line-height: 150%;
}
```
通过使用相对单位或百分比来设置line-height,可以实现文本行高度的自适应效果。
body line-height
回答: 在CSS中,line-height(行高)是指两行文字基线之间的距离。可以使用具体长度值或相对单位来设置行高,例如1.5em、1.5rem、20px或20pt。\[1\]基线是指英文字母"x"的下端沿,不同字体的基线可能不尽相同。\[2\]行内框盒子模型是指在一个行内元素中,文字和其他行内元素都被包裹在一个框盒子中。\[2\]关于body的line-height,需要在CSS中指定具体的值,可以是具体长度值或相对单位,以设置整个页面的行高。
#### 引用[.reference_title]
- *1* *3* [CSS深入理解之line-height](https://blog.csdn.net/literarygirl/article/details/122899189)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control_2,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[深入理解CSS中的line-height的使用](https://blog.csdn.net/m0_46374969/article/details/112390366)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^control_2,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]